Leishmania mexicana flagellar proteome knockout library: validation of knockout mutants

Options
  • Details
  • Files
Project description
We generated an arrayed CRISPR-Cas9 knockout library for the majority of proteins identified in the motile flagellum proteome (Beneke T et al. (2019) PLoS Pathog 15(6): e1007828. https://doi.org/10.1371/journal.ppat.1007828 and Beneke T et al. (2020) J Cell Sci. 2020 Jan 23;133(2):jcs239855. doi: 10.1242/jcs.239855). This screen targeted 629 genes in total, and produced 473 null mutant lines, 53 lines where a copy of the target gene remained in the genome (‘incomplete deletions’). For 89 target genes no viable transfectants were obtained.
